The QueryProfiler type exposes the following members.
Initializes a new instance of the QueryProfiler class
Adds custom context information to the next query executed by the currently profiled DataContext.
Adds custom context information for all subsequent queries executed by the currently profiled DataContext.
|BeforeExecute(IActionQuery, IDbTransaction, DataAccessAdapterBase)|
|BeforeExecute(IRetrievalQuery, IDbTransaction, DataAccessAdapterBase)|
Releases all resources used by the QueryProfiler.
Destructor for the QueryProfiler class.(Overrides Object..::..Finalize()()()().)
Serves as a hash function for a particular type.(Inherited from Object.)
Gets the Type of the current instance.(Inherited from Object.)
Creates a shallow copy of the current Object.(Inherited from Object.)
Set/Get custom profiler context information for the current profiling session.
The AfterSerializing event is fired after a profiler log entry is serialized (or queued for serialization in case of asynchronous log writes).
The BeforeSerializing event is fired before a QueryInformation object (LLBLGen Profiler log entry) is about to be serialized.
The FilteredOut event is fired if a profiler log entry is excluded from the log by a filter.
The LogError event is raised if the profiler fails to write to the log. Sender is the profiler entry that couldn't be written, event arguments contain a LogErrorEventArgs instance with details on what caused the failure.